HC Deb 09 February 1937 vol 320 cc237-8W
Mr. R. Duckworth

asked the Minister of Health whether he can give the number of applicants for public assistance on the latest date available and also for the date six months previously?

Sir K. Wood

The total numbers of persons in receipt of poor relief in England and Wales (including dependants but excluding rate-aided patients in mental hospitals and persons in receipt of domiciliary medical relief only) on 16th January, 1937 (the latest date available) were 1,289,927 and on the 18th July, 1936, 1,228,026.
